How Often Should You Schedule Professional Cleaning?
How regularly should property owners plan for scheduling professional carpet cleaning to preserve a healthy living environment? Industry experts recommend that households with low foot traffic have cleaned their carpets at least once every year. However, families with children, pets, or high foot traffic may have to book cleanings every six months or even quarterly. The frequency can also rely on the type of carpet and its fibers, as some materials may require more frequent maintenance to preserve their aesthetic appeal and longevity.
For people with allergic conditions, more frequent cleaning is suggested to minimize dust, allergens, and pollutants that can collect in carpets. Additionally, seasonal changes can influence cleaning needs, especially during periods of elevated outdoor activity. Homeowners should assess their personal circumstances, including lifestyle and carpet condition, to establish an appropriate cleaning schedule. Regular professional cleaning not only increases carpet longevity but also fosters a safer home environment.

Removing Odors and Stains Efficiently
Stains and odors can greatly detract from a home's look and livability, making thorough removal vital for upholding a welcoming environment. Over time, spills, pet accidents, and general wear can result in stubborn stains and lingering scents that common cleaning solutions typically fail to eradicate. Professional carpet cleaning services utilize specialized equipment and cleaning solutions engineered to tackle these issues more effectively than traditional approaches.
For example, hot water extraction penetrates deeply into carpet fibers, dislodging dirt and stains while concurrently removing odors at their origin. Moreover, experienced technicians hold the proficiency to recognize the proper treatment for diverse stain types, like wine, ink, or grease. This precise method not only eliminates visible blemishes but also aids in preventing subsequent damage to the carpet. Through investment in professional cleaning, property owners can revitalize their carpets, guaranteeing a fresh, pristine space that improves both appearance and comfort.
Picking the Best Carpet Cleaning Company
Selecting the appropriate carpet cleaning service can greatly impact the effectiveness of stain and odor removal efforts. To guarantee ideal results, homeowners should consider several key factors. First, it is essential to assess the company’s reputation. Online reviews and testimonials provide insight into past customer experiences and satisfaction levels. Additionally, evaluating the range of services offered is vital. Some companies specialize in specific cleaning methods, such as steam cleaning or dry cleaning, which may be more suitable for particular carpet types.
Licensing and insurance are also important considerations; a reliable service should possess proper certifications and coverage to safeguard both the client and their property. Additionally, obtaining quotes from multiple companies can help homeowners make informed decisions based on available funds and expected outcomes. By thoughtfully considering these factors, individuals can choose a carpet cleaning service that fulfills their needs and contributes to a healthier home environment.
Common Questions
Could Professional Carpet Cleaning Damage My Carpet Fibers?
High-quality carpet cleaning, when executed appropriately, should not deteriorate carpet fibers. Nonetheless, improper techniques or harsh chemicals can lead to wear and tear. It's essential to hire experienced professionals to safeguard the carpet's longevity and integrity.
Can You Get Eco-Friendly Carpet Cleaning Solutions?
Indeed, eco-friendly cleaning alternatives are accessible for carpet cleaning. These products are formulated to effectively clean carpets while reducing environmental impact, guaranteeing a safer alternative for both the home and the planet.

Will Professional Cleaning Get Rid of Pet Hair Completely?
Professional cleaning can greatly reduce pet hair from carpets, but complete removal isn't always assured. Variables like carpet type and cleaning method affect effectiveness, and some residual hair might still persist after treatment.
Is Walking on Just-Cleaned Carpets Allowed Right Away?
Stepping on newly cleaned carpets straight away is usually not advised. You should wait a minimum of several hours for the carpets to dry completely, ensuring ideal results and preventing damage to the clean surface.
